Bob & Satish, thanks for your comments. The fungi were growing on a rotten log, to make life easier I placed the log in a clearing. The light was very low under the woodland canopy so I took a number of exposures using the histogram as guidance. I also used a sheet of aluminium baking foil to reflect the light but for the most part it did not work too well becasue the sun was so bright that day. I did manage on this shot to just glance the fungi with a little light.
